What is Ferrous Gluconate?
Ferrous gluconate is a type of iron supplement that is often used to treat or prevent iron deficiency anemia. It is a salt of gluconic acid and ferrous iron (Fe2+), which is one of the two available forms of dietary iron. Ferrous gluconate is favored for its relatively gentle effect on the stomach compared to other iron supplements, such as ferrous sulfate.
Benefits of Ferrous Gluconate
1. Gentle on the Stomach: One of the main advantages of ferrous gluconate is that it is less likely to cause gastrointestinal side effects such as constipation or nausea, making it suitable for individuals who may be sensitive to other forms of iron.
2. Effective Absorption: Ferrous gluconate is well absorbed by the body, which is essential for those who need to increase their iron levels quickly.
3. Availability: It is widely available in pharmacies and health stores, making it an accessible option for many individuals.
What is Heme Iron?
Heme iron is a form of iron that is derived primarily from animal sources. It is found in hemoglobin and myoglobin, proteins that are responsible for transporting oxygen in the blood and muscles. The main dietary sources of heme iron include red meat, poultry, and fish.
Benefits of Heme Iron
1. Superior Absorption: Heme iron is absorbed more efficiently by the body compared to non-heme iron (which is found in plant sources). This makes it an excellent choice for individuals who are trying to increase their iron levels.
2. Rich Nutritional Profile: Foods rich in heme iron often contain other essential nutrients, such as protein, zinc, and B vitamins, which contribute to overall health.
3. Less Impact from Dietary Factors: The absorption of heme iron is less affected by other dietary components, such as phytates and polyphenols, which can inhibit the absorption of non-heme iron.
Ferrous Gluconate vs. Heme Iron: Which is Better?
The choice between ferrous gluconate and heme iron largely depends on individual dietary preferences and health needs. Here are some factors to consider:
– Dietary Preferences: If you follow a vegetarian or vegan diet, you may find it challenging to obtain sufficient heme iron, making ferrous gluconate a viable alternative. Conversely, if you consume meat, you may benefit more from heme iron sources.
– Iron Deficiency Severity: For those with significant iron deficiency, heme iron may provide a more rapid increase in iron levels due to its superior absorption rate.
– Gastrointestinal Tolerance: Individuals who experience side effects from iron supplements may prefer ferrous gluconate due to its milder impact on the stomach.
